Warning Signs You Need Industrial Dehumidification in Your Flat Rock, NC Home
Ignoring these warning signs can lead to costly repairs, structural damage, and even health risks. Don’t take the risk, contact us today if you notice any of the following: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ant smells coming from your walls, floors, or ceilings can show a moisture issue. If the odor persists even after cleaning, it’s a sign that you need our help.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Discolored patches or water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a leak or high moisture levels. Don’t ignore these signs, they could lead to costly repairs down the line.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ause your floors to warp or buckle, creating uneven surfaces and tripping hazards. This is a sign that you need our Industrial Dehumidification services to prevent further damage.
Condensation on Windows and Surfaces
Visible condensation on your windows, walls, or other surfaces is a sign that your home is too humid. This can lead to mold growth, structural damage, and health risks.
Unpleasant Odors from Your HVAC System
Strong smells coming from your air vents or HVAC system can show a buildup of moisture and bacteria. This is a sign that you need our help to clean and dehumidify your system.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of high moisture levels or water damage. This is a warning sign that you need our Industrial Dehumidification services to prevent further damage.

Industrial Dehumidification Cost in Flat Rock, NC
The cost of Industrial Dehumidification services in Flat Rock, NC,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on our expertise and experience with similar jobs in the area. Keep in mind that prices may vary depending on the specifics of your situ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Moisture assessment and reading equipment |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of the issue |
| High-capacity dehumidification and drying equipment |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, duration of the drying process |
| Containment and prep services |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, complexity of the issue |
